Biography
Lumsden Hare (17 October 1874 – 28 August 1964) was an Irish born film and theatre actor. He was also a theatre director and theatrical producer.
Biography
Born Francis Lumsden Hare in Tipperary, Ireland, he appeared in more than thirty-five Broadway productions in New York City between 1900 and 1942. He served as director and/or producer for various productions, some starring himself.
He started appearing in films in 1916. By his last screen appearance in 1961, Hare had appeared in more than 140 films and over a dozen television productions. He died, age 89, in Beverly Hills, California.
